NBK Capital collaborated with INSEAD, the leading international business school, to provide strategy training for senior managers of its portfolio companies. The intensive two-day program focused on strategy formation, implementation and monitoring. The interactive sessions provided an environment for the investment team and business managers to share knowledge and leverage experiences across the portfolio.

The event was part of the "NBK Capital Seminar Series", which is an ongoing private event where thought leaders from the financial industry share insights, knowledge and innovation with interested professionals and investors across the region. This is the fifth installment of the series following highly successful events in Dubai, Saudi Arabia and Kuwait.
The Alternative Investments Group at NBK Capital manages c. USD 600 million of assets under management focused on growth capital for mid-market companies located throughout MENA and Turkey. The Group's track record includes private equity and mezzanine investments in Saudi Arabia, Kuwait, Qatar, UAE and Turkey. About NBK Capital
NBK Capital was established in July 2005 as a subsidiary of the National Bank of Kuwait (NBK),one of the region's oldest and highest rated banks. NBK Capital focuses on four principal lines of business: Alternative Investments, Asset Management, Brokerage & Research and Investment Banking. With offices in Kuwait, Dubai, Turkey, and Cairo, NBK Capital's team of more than 170 professionals offer superior products and services to clients and investors.
